Practice hoping to find new GPs
Ballasalla Medical Centre says it's hopeful to find new GPs for the practice, but admits it can't continue past six months unless support is provided.
The practice recently handed back its contract to Manx Care, and says discussions with the health body opened last week to consider the options available.
The decision was not taken lightly, it says, adding the surgery is trying hard to recruit new GPs both on and off Island.
Help is needed, it says, because it's been struggling with clinical staff following the resignation of the Senior Partner and long term sickness of the other Partner.
While the six-month time frame has been put in place, patients have been urged previously not to register with another GP just yet.
Ballasalla Medical Centre says it's 'business as usual' for the time being.
